Transaction 559e76d43d38866c2b87207ffbe05e18ea5dbfe305eb7c83d75f9803bc16f37d
1 Input
1 Output
-
559e76d43d38866c2b87207ffbe05e18ea5dbfe305eb7c83d75f9803bc16f37d:0
- value
- 26414909
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0cc42f7f26604aa1331b2847515d19142e95b5ee OP_EQUAL
- address
- 32rX44BF5eLUnfGjiqUfJ2aqxjMrsgH78g